Think-cell builds a PowerPoint add-in that lets business professionals create advanced charts—such as waterfall, Gantt, and Mekko charts—inside PowerPoint with ease. The add-in automates formatting, layout, and chart generation so users can produce complex, presentation-ready visuals quickly without manual tweaking. It markets licenses to individuals and companies, serving a global audience with a strong footprint in Europe and North America. Compared with other charting tools, think-cell focuses specifically on PowerPoint data-visualization workflows, delivering specialized chart types and automated formatting to speed up the creation of data-driven presentations. The company's goal is to help users save time and improve productivity by turning data into clear, professional visuals within PowerPoint.

Simplify's Take

What believers are saying

  • think-cell Assist launched in 2026, opening upsell revenue from existing Suite customers.
  • Thirty-five thousand companies already rely on think-cell, giving strong cross-sell and retention leverage.
  • Bloomberg-linked reports cite roughly €200 million ARR and €150 million EBITDA, signaling strong profitability.

What critics are saying

  • Cinven began exploring a 2026 sale, forcing think-cell into valuation and ownership disruption.
  • Microsoft can bundle smarter native charting and AI into PowerPoint, compressing think-cell's advantage.
  • If think-cell Assist stumbles on trust, security, or model quality, enterprise renewals weaken fast.

What makes think-cell unique

  • think-cell 14 bundles 40-plus PowerPoint chart types for consulting-grade slides.
  • think-cell Assist integrates AI chat, chart generation, translation, and web search inside PowerPoint.
  • think-cell serves 1.3 million users across 180 countries, anchoring a deep enterprise standard.
